micrometastasis logo #21579Small numbers of cancer cells that have spread from the primary tumor to other parts of the body and are too few to be picked up in a screening or diagnostic test.

micrometastasis logo #21219Type: Term Pronunciation: mī′krō-mĕ-tas′tă-sis Definitions: 1. A stage of metastasis when the secondary tumors are too small to be clinically detected, as in micrometastatic disease.
